I'd found our new chief information officer in Stephen Gillett, a 32-year-old from outside the retail industry. It appeared that Stephen would be the youngest CIO of a Fortune 500 company, which made some question whether he could handle the immense job of overhauling our ancient technological infrastructure. But Stephen brought a rich combination of technical acumen, valuable digital media knowledge, and insatiable curiosity to the table, all of which he'd honed at the digital media company Corbis, as well as at Yahoo! and CNET. I was also impressed by Stephen's dynamic thought process, and I sensed a good heart behind his wide grin.
